Output 58009a691c393261089ad7e1c1f1e99d88941aa8d5e432a20b97248e2a295e95:1

value
151000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ab51041c5bd8b30cdb1afdf5c82033d98bd2f1 OP_EQUAL
address
34rL8Lqsbsr95HUbU82YHhnwYFsz92DLqt
transaction
58009a691c393261089ad7e1c1f1e99d88941aa8d5e432a20b97248e2a295e95